An Accurate Map of Europe Drawn from the Best Authorities. Robert Wilkinson. London, c1794.

This map has beautiful contemporary hand-colour that really makes it very decorative as well as interesting.  Original copperplate-engraved map published circa 1794 for the first edition of The General Atlas of the World by Robert Wilkinson.

Wilkinson acquired the engraved plates of his maps from the estate of map publisher John Bowles. A well-respected mapmaker in London between 1768 and his death in 1825, Wilkinson achieved most renown by updating and reissuing the plates for this edition of his General Atlas, which he re-issued in 1802 and 1809.
